04-15: Development of an On-site Hypobromite GeneratorExisting technology for biological control of cooling water systems uses costly, dangerous to handle, toxic chemicals. In order to eliminate the many problems associated with this technology, a program was started several years ago to develop a system to produce Hypobromite on site from harmless neutral salts using the process of electrolysis.
